Scientists have revealed that positive reinforcement and benefits are a lot more efficient for generally better behavior results than penalty alone, for all people, not simply kids with autism. Applied Actions Evaluation (ABA) is one of one of the most efficient interventions to transform actions, and it is backed by evidence-based study. Via ABA, specialists can establish a child's recommended products, tasks and methods of interacting, in addition to the unique triggers and consequences that are affecting a kid's actions. Another misconception about actions is that it belongs to a youngster's personality and diagnosis, and therefore can't be transformed.

Similar to any person, youngsters with autism can adapt their behavior, with the right help. Applied habits analysis (ABA) is among one of the most researched and proven therapy approaches to aid youngsters with autism break problem habits.
